手机扩容如何写数据库

手机扩容如何写数据库

手机扩容如何写数据库?
使用云存储、外部存储设备、优化数据库设计、数据压缩技术是手机扩容写数据库的核心方法。其中,使用云存储是一种非常有效的方法,可以大大增加数据存储的灵活性和容量。云存储服务提供商通常提供冗余和备份服务,这意味着即使手机丢失或损坏,数据也能得到保护。此外,使用云存储可以让用户在不同设备之间无缝访问数据,提高了数据管理的便利性和安全性。

一、使用云存储

云存储是一种通过互联网将数据存储在远程服务器上的技术。对于手机用户,云存储可以大大扩展存储容量,同时提供数据备份和同步功能。

  1. 云存储的优点

    云存储服务提供商如Google Drive、Dropbox和iCloud,允许用户将数据存储在云端。这样可以释放手机的本地存储空间,同时确保数据的安全性。用户可以在不同设备之间无缝访问数据,提高了工作和生活的便利性。

  2. 如何选择合适的云存储服务

    选择云存储服务时,需要考虑存储空间、速度、安全性和费用等因素。不同的云存储服务提供不同的免费存储空间和付费计划,用户可以根据自己的需求选择合适的服务。

二、使用外部存储设备

外部存储设备如SD卡和OTG(On-The-Go)设备也可以帮助扩展手机的存储容量。

  1. SD卡

    许多安卓手机支持SD卡扩展,用户可以购买大容量的SD卡来增加存储空间。将不常用的数据(如照片、视频和音乐)存储在SD卡上,可以释放手机的内部存储空间。

  2. OTG设备

    OTG设备允许手机通过USB接口连接U盘或外部硬盘。这样,用户可以将大量数据存储在外部设备上,而不是占用手机的内部存储空间。

三、优化数据库设计

数据库设计的优化可以显著提高存储效率,减少不必要的存储空间占用。

  1. 规范化数据库设计

    规范化数据库设计可以减少数据冗余,提高数据一致性。通过将数据分解成更小的表,并通过关系将它们连接起来,可以减少重复数据的存储,从而节省存储空间。

  2. 索引优化

    为数据库表创建适当的索引,可以提高查询效率,减少数据读取时间。虽然索引本身会占用一些存储空间,但它带来的查询效率提升可以显著减少数据库操作的时间成本。

四、数据压缩技术

数据压缩技术可以显著减少数据的存储空间需求,特别是在处理大量文本或多媒体数据时。

  1. 文本压缩

    使用压缩算法如gzip或bzip2,可以将文本数据压缩到原始大小的很小比例。这样可以大大减少存储空间需求,同时在传输数据时也可以提高速度。

  2. 多媒体数据压缩

    对于照片、视频和音频等多媒体数据,可以使用不同的压缩格式(如JPEG、MP4和MP3)来减少文件大小。虽然压缩会导致一定程度的质量损失,但在大多数情况下,这种损失是可以接受的。

五、数据生命周期管理

数据生命周期管理(Data Lifecycle Management, DLM)是一种通过定义数据的创建、使用、存储和删除周期来优化存储资源的方法。

  1. 定义数据生命周期

    根据数据的重要性和使用频率,定义不同类型数据的生命周期策略。例如,近期使用的数据可以保存在高性能存储设备上,而不常用的历史数据可以移到较低成本的存储设备上。

  2. 自动化数据迁移

    使用自动化工具实现数据迁移,可以在数据生命周期的不同阶段自动将数据从一个存储设备迁移到另一个存储设备。这样可以在保证数据可用性的同时,优化存储资源的使用。

六、使用项目团队管理系统

在团队协作和项目管理过程中,选择合适的项目管理系统可以提高工作效率,同时优化数据存储和管理。

  1. 研发项目管理系统PingCode

    PingCode是一款专为研发团队设计的项目管理系统,支持多种数据存储和共享方式,帮助团队高效管理项目数据。PingCode提供的云端存储功能,可以帮助团队成员随时随地访问和更新数据。

  2. 通用项目协作软件Worktile

    Worktile是一款通用项目协作软件,适用于各种类型的团队。通过Worktile,团队成员可以方便地共享文件、分配任务和跟踪项目进度。Worktile的云存储功能可以帮助团队优化数据存储和管理,提高协作效率。

七、数据清理和归档

定期清理和归档数据可以释放存储空间,同时保持数据的整洁和可管理性。

  1. 数据清理

    定期清理不再需要的数据,如旧的照片、视频和应用缓存,可以释放大量存储空间。使用专业的清理工具,可以快速识别和删除不必要的数据。

  2. 数据归档

    对于不常用但需要保留的数据,可以将其归档到外部存储设备或云存储中。这样可以释放手机的内部存储空间,同时确保数据的安全性和可访问性。

八、数据库分区和分片

数据库分区和分片技术可以提高数据库的存储效率和查询性能。

  1. 数据库分区

    数据库分区是将一个大表分割成多个较小的表,每个表存储不同范围的数据。这样可以提高查询性能,同时减少单个表的存储空间需求。

  2. 数据库分片

    数据库分片是将数据库的数据分割到多个独立的数据库实例上,每个实例存储部分数据。这样可以提高数据库的可扩展性和性能,同时减少单个数据库实例的存储压力。

通过上述方法,手机用户可以大大扩展其存储容量,同时优化数据管理和存储效率。无论是使用云存储、外部存储设备,还是优化数据库设计和数据压缩技术,这些方法都可以帮助用户更高效地管理和存储数据。

相关问答FAQs:

1. 如何将手机内存扩容并写入数据库?

  • Q: 我想将手机内存扩容并将数据写入数据库,应该如何操作?
  • A: 首先,您可以使用外部存储设备(如SD卡或USB闪存驱动器)将手机内存扩容。然后,您需要打开手机上的数据库管理工具,并选择将数据写入新的扩展存储设备中的数据库。

2. 手机内存不足时,如何将数据存储到数据库中?

  • Q: 当手机内存不足时,我应该如何将数据存储到数据库中?
  • A: 您可以使用数据库管理工具将数据存储到手机的内部数据库中。在存储数据之前,您可以通过清理手机中不必要的文件和应用程序来释放一些内存空间,以确保数据库能够正常运行。

3. 如何将手机中的照片和视频存储到数据库中进行扩容?

  • Q: 我想将手机中的照片和视频存储到数据库中以扩容内存,应该如何操作?
  • A: 首先,您可以使用数据库管理工具创建一个新的数据库。然后,您可以将手机中的照片和视频通过选择导入功能将它们导入到数据库中。这样,您就可以通过扩展数据库的容量来存储更多的照片和视频文件。

原创文章,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/1857614

(0)
Edit2Edit2
上一篇 4天前
下一篇 4天前
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部